A 79-year-old female presented with progressive dyspnea. A bone marrow biopsy revealed hypoplastic marrow with abnormal lymphoid cells. A genetic analysis revealed a MYD88 p.V204F mutation, supporting the diagnosis of lymphoplasmacytic lymphoma/Waldenström's macroglobulinemia (LPL/WM). Additional evaluations established a concomitant diagnosis of aplastic anemia (AA). Treatment prioritized AA with cyclosporine and eltrombopag. Subsequently, the LPL/WM was treated with rituximab monotherapy. This sequential treatment resulted in a symptomatic improvement. Although AA is a diagnosis of exclusion, its coexistence with lymphoma is rare. This case highlights the diagnostic and therapeutic complexity of AA and LPL/WM overlap and suggests that prioritizing the treatment of AA may lead to better outcomes. Show less

In the present study, we investigated the association between susceptible genetic variants to age-related macular degeneration (AMD) and response to as-needed intravitreal aflibercept injection (IAI) therapy for exudative AMD including both typical neovascular AMD and polypoidal choroidal vasculopathy (PCV) over 12-months. A total of 234 patients with exudative AMD were initially treated with 3 monthly IAI and thereafter as-needed IAI over 12 months. Seven variants of 6 genes including ARMS2 A69S (rs10490924), CFH (I62V:rs800292 and rs1329428), C2-CFB-SKIV2L(rs429608), C3 (rs2241394), CETP (rs3764261) and ADAMTS-9 (rs6795735) were genotyped for all participants using TaqMan technology. After adjusting for age, gender, baseline BCVA and AMD subtype, A (protective) allele of C2-CFB-SKIV2L rs429608 was associated with visual improvement at 12-month (P = 0.003).
